Discover the beauty of Bratislava on this full-day tour. Explore the city's historic center with an expert English-speaking guide and return to Vienna by boat, enjoying views as you cruise down the Danube.
Day Trip + Cruise Details
Early in the morning, you will be picked up from your hotel and travel to Bratislava by bus, arriving after an hour. You'll have a 2.5-hour guided tour of the city's historic center.
The first stop is the 18th-century Plague Column, followed by a stroll through the pedestrian area to the National Theater. You'll walk along the promenade, passing several cafés.
Sights include Michael's Gate, the historic City Hall, and Maximilian Fountain. The tour concludes at St. Martin's Cathedral, the site of Hungarian kings' coronations.
After the guided portion, you will have 6 hours of free time to explore, eat, or shop in the city.
In the afternoon, head to the dock at Razus Embankment to board the "Twin City Liner" catamaran. The boat will take you back to Vienna with unique views from the Danube.
After a 1.5-hour voyage, you disembark at Schwedenplatz and conclude the tour after 8 to 11.5 hours.
Return to Vienna by Boat
It is essential to arrive on time at the Bratislava pier, located on Rázusovo Nábrežie Street. Departure times from Bratislava vary, and the tour guide will provide the exact time on the day of the tour.
